    Smilodon fatalis: Over 2.000 individuals represented by more than 130.000 specimens. Smilodon is among the most well-known mammals from Rancho La Brea and the second most common carnivore found in the pits, only behind the dire wolf. Unlike the American lion, which is a true cat, Smilodon was a member of the Machairodontinae.

    Physically, the cat reached around 1 m (3.3 ft) tall at the shoulder, [7] and is estimated about the same size or larger than Smilodon fatalis, though the body mass estimates of the holotype is around 118 kilograms (260 lb). [8] [9] A 2019 book suggested a body mass range of 300–350 kilograms (660–770 lb). [10]
